Types of Coffee Makers Available Online


When searching for a coffee maker, comprehending the different types can assist narrow down your choices. Here are some popular types available in the UK:

Type of Coffee Maker

Description

Suitable For

Drip Coffee Maker

Standard technique where water leaks through ground coffee in a filter.

Daily coffee drinkers who choose a basic developing procedure.

Espresso Machine

Uses pressure to brew a focused coffee shot.

Espresso fans and those who enjoy specialized coffee drinks.

Single-Serve Brewer

Uses pods or capsules to brew one cup at a time.

People or small homes looking for benefit.

French Press

A manual technique where coffee grounds steep in hot water before pressing.

Those who value a rich and full-bodied cup of coffee.

Cold Brew Maker

Designed specifically for brewing coffee with cold water over a prolonged duration.

Those who prefer cold coffee drinks and wish to try out new flavours.

Percolator

A standard method where water cycles through coffee grounds consistently till wanted strength is accomplished.

Users who take pleasure in a strong, vibrant coffee.

Frequently asked questions


1. What is the very best coffee maker for home use?

The very best coffee maker for home usage depends on specific choices. Leak coffee makers are ideal for households that brew multiple cups daily, while single-serve machines are fantastic for those who take pleasure in different kinds of coffee or who brew infrequently.

2. Are expensive coffee machine worth it?

Pricey coffee makers often come with advanced functions, better build quality, and a longer life-span. They can be worth the financial investment if one is major about coffee quality and ease of usage.

3. For how long do coffee makers last?

The life expectancy of a coffee maker can differ significantly. Usually, they last anywhere from 5 to 10 years, depending upon brand name, usage, and upkeep.

4. Can I return a coffee machine if I don't like it?

A lot of online sellers have return policies that allow clients to return items within a particular timeframe. Always check the particular return policy before acquiring.

5. How do I maintain my coffee machine?

Regular cleaning is vital for maintaining a coffee maker. Follow maker guidelines for cleansing and descaling to ensure longevity and ideal efficiency.
